fastVoteR: Efficient Voting Methods for Committee Selection

Description

A fast 'Rcpp'-based implementation of polynomially-computable voting theory methods for committee ranking and scoring. The package includes methods such as Approval Voting (AV), Satisfaction Approval Voting (SAV), sequential Proportional Approval Voting (PAV), and sequential Phragmen's Rule. Weighted variants of these methods are also provided, allowing for differential voter influence.
